LCRIG has announced that entries are now open for the DfT Special Recognition Apprentice Awards 2026. Now in their second year, these prestigious awards shine a spotlight on the exceptional talent, dedication, and ambition of apprentices within the highways and road infrastructure technology sector. They celebrate young professionals who are making outstanding contributions early in their careers and driving innovation, growth, and excellence in our sector.
Sponsored by WJ Group, the awards form part of the Innovation and Learning Festival, taking place from 24-25 June 2026 at the NAEC Stoneleigh. The awards presentation will form part of the evening networking event held on 24 June – a relaxed and informal celebration showcasing the future of our sector.
Award Categories:
DfT Special Recognition Inspirational Apprentice Award
Recognising apprentices who go above and beyond to motivate and inspire others, acting as role models for their peers and ambassadors for the industry. These individuals not only excel in their roles but also make a positive and lasting impact on colleagues, the wider sector, and their communities.
DfT Special Recognition Exceptional Frontline Apprentice Award
Celebrating apprentices in frontline roles who demonstrate exceptional skills, innovation, reliability, and a commitment to making a tangible difference in their teams, workplaces, and communities.
DfT Special Recognition Outstanding Achievement Award
Level 2, Level 3, and Level 4-6 Apprenticeship Awards
Honouring apprentices at each level who have demonstrated exceptional dedication, personal growth, and professional excellence, contributing positively to both their workplace and the wider community.
New for 2026 – Employer Recognition
Excellence in Apprenticeship Delivery – Employer Award
This new award celebrates employers who champion apprenticeship delivery, providing high-quality programmes that empower apprentices, support workforce development, and promote inclusion and opportunity. It recognises organisations setting the benchmark for skills development across the highways and road infrastructure technology sector.
Apprentice Competition
Future of Local Roads: Apprentice Innovation Competition
We’re inviting apprentices to propose innovative solutions to real-world highways or transportation-related challenges in their local area – whether improving safety, efficiency, accessibility, or sustainability on our local networks.
The winner will showcase their ideas to industry leaders, receiving recognition, promotion through LCRIG platforms, and a £1,000 cash prize.

The DfT Special Recognition Apprentice Awards are open to all, with nominations welcomed from employers, training providers, or directly from apprentices themselves.
Please note, shortlisted entrants will be required to be represented at the awards ceremony.
Public sector and private sector individual delegate places and tables at the awards evening are available, with fully funded places for apprentices. Book here.
Key Dates
- Entry Deadline: 5pm, Friday 27 March 2026
- Shortlist Announcement: April 2026
- Awards Ceremony: 24 June 2026
